Customer Support Consultant I - Lab Liaison

IDEXX · Greensboro, NC · Yesterday
OTHR$23/hrFull-time

About the role

This is a full-time position with excellent day-one benefits. For more information about laboratory jobs at IDEXX, visit: https://careers.idexx.com/us/en/referencelaboratories

Responsibilities

  • Provide proactive customer outreach and resolve issues promptly to ensure an optimal customer experience.
  • Collaborate with team members across IDEXX to research and resolve Reference Lab customer concerns and lab sample testing issues.
  • Maintain strong internal and external customer relationships through professional, clear, and empathetic communication.
  • Support quality management systems and compliance requirements.
  • Contribute to team growth through active participation in development programs and collaborative knowledge sharing.

Requirements

  • High School diploma or equivalent required; Associate or Bachelor’s degree preferred.
  • Strong customer service and interpersonal skills with experience in building and maintaining relationships.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office and other relevant systems, with technical aptitude to learn new tools, lab processes, and diagnostic terminology.
  • Analytical and problem-solving skills to research and resolve issues effectively, using critical thinking to make sound decisions.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ills, with the ability to explain complex information clearly and professionally.
  • Ability to work collaboratively in a team-oriented environment, including across international teams and diverse cultures.
  • Commitment to continuous learning and improvement, staying current with evolving processes, tools, and industry standards.
  • Ability to handle challenging conversations with professionalism and empathy, ensuring customer needs are met throughout the process.
  • Strong attention to detail and dedication to data accuracy and integrity to support compliance and quality standards.
  • Reliable and dependable attendance is an essential function of this position.

Benefits

  • Health / dental / vision benefits
  • day one 5% matching 401k
  • On-the-job training and career advancement opportunities
  • Additional benefits including but not limited to financial support, pet insurance, mental health resources, volunteer paid days off, employee stock program, foundation donation matching, and more

Pay

Pay targeting $23 / hr

Schedule

  • This is a full-time, 40hr per week position
  • The schedule for this position is: Monday - Friday
  • The hours for this position are: 8:30am-5:00pm
  • The starting hours are flexible (+/- 2hrs)
  • The shifts and hours may vary slightly depending on business needs.
  • Reliable and dependable attendance is an essential function of this position.
